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
654 824294854 7235191618 6929493 503227
7655176 312871 7693750
7655176 312871 7693750
80695885453 93 96432 4160855
All about undefined
Interested in learning more?
7655176 312871 7693750
80695885453 93 96432 4160855
See more
597 37 07189636877
7413 5726 429
See more
74058 8939651291
489705887 5536909444 478534478
See more